Herbarium of the University of Florida Plants of Florida Sisvrinchium corvmbosum Bicknell Flowers 12-14 mm. broad, perianth light violet with yellow eye; capsules immature; leaves shorter than 1st node on stem, 2.5- 3.0 mm. broad; stems few-many (±50), erect, forked, winged, 2.5-3.0 mm. broad, purple tinged and non-geniculate at nodes; plants sparsely fibrous at base, cespitose, to 40 cm. Common; moist sandy loam of shallow roadside ditch through low pine woodland, along secondary road (CR 137) between US 301 and US 1, ca. 9 mi. n. of Folkston, CHARLTON County. coll. Daniel B. Ward 10734 7 May 2003 with 6. C. Ward det. D. B. W. ref. Castanea 70:155-157. 2005. 03853191
